计算机二级MySQL考试模拟测试试题及答案
姓名:____________________
一、单项选择题(每题2分,共10题)
1.MySQL数据库中,以下哪个关键字用于创建一个新表?
A.CREATETABLE
B.INSERTINTO
C.SELECTINTO
D.UPDATETABLE
2.在MySQL中,以下哪个函数用于获取当前日期和时间?
A.GETDATE()
B.CURRENT_DATE()
C.DATE()
D.NOW()
3.以下哪个命令用于删除一个数据库?
A.DROPDATABASE
B.DELETEDATABASE
C.REMOVEDATABASE
D.ERASEDATABASE
4.在MySQL中,以下哪个关键字用于限制一个列的长度?
A.LENGTH
B.LIMIT
C.SIZE
D.MAX_LENGTH
5.在MySQL中,以下哪个命令用于显示数据库中的所有表?
A.SHOWTABLES
B.LISTTABLES
C.DISPLAYTABLES
D.VIEWTABLES
6.以下哪个函数用于将字符串转换为整数?
A.STR_TO_INT()
B.INT_TO_STR()
C.CAST()
D.CONVERT()
7.在MySQL中,以下哪个关键字用于创建一个索引?
A.INDEX
B.CREATEINDEX
C.BUILDINDEX
D.MAKEINDEX
8.以下哪个命令用于更新表中的数据?
A.UPDATETABLE
B.MODIFYTABLE
C.ALTERTABLE
D.CHANGETABLE
9.在MySQL中,以下哪个关键字用于删除表中的记录?
A.DELETEFROM
B.REMOVEFROM
C.DROPFROM
D.KILLFROM
10.以下哪个函数用于获取字符串的长度?
A.LEN()
B.LENGTH()
C.SIZE()
D.LENGTH_OF()
二、填空题(每空2分,共10分)
1.在MySQL中,使用______关键字可以创建一个新数据库。
2.以下SQL语句用于插入数据到表中:______INTOtable_name(column1,column2)VALUES(value1,value2)。
3.在MySQL中,可以使用______函数来获取当前日期和时间。
4.删除数据库的SQL语句为:______database_name。
5.在MySQL中,可以使用______关键字来创建一个索引。
6.以下SQL语句用于更新表中的数据:______table_nameSETcolumn1=value1,column2=value2WHEREcondition。
7.在MySQL中,可以使用______函数将字符串转换为整数。
8.删除表中的记录的SQL语句为:______FROMtable_nameWHEREcondition。
9.在MySQL中,可以使用______函数来获取字符串的长度。
10.以下SQL语句用于显示数据库中的所有表:______TABLES。
三、判断题(每题2分,共10分)
1.在MySQL中,可以使用SELECT语句直接创建一个新表。()
2.使用ALTERTABLE语句可以修改表的结构。()
3.在MySQL中,可以使用LIKE关键字进行模糊查询。()
4.使用DELETE语句可以删除表中的所有记录。()
5.在MySQL中,可以使用LIMIT关键字限制查询结果的数量。()
6.使用DROPTABLE语句可以删除一个表及其所有数据。()
7.在MySQL中,可以使用CONCAT函数连接两个字符串。()
8.使用ORDERBY关键字可以对查询结果进行排序。()
9.在MySQL中,可以使用GROUPBY关键字对数据进行分组。()
10.使用INSERTINTO语句可以插入多条记录到表中。()
四、简答题(每题5分,共10分)
1.简述MySQL中创建数据库和表的步骤。
2.简述MySQL中删除数据库和表的步骤。
二、多项选择题(每题3分,共10题)
1.以下哪些是MySQL支持的数字数据类型?
A.INT
B.FLOAT
C.DOUBLE
D.DECIMAL
E.DATE
2.在MySQL中,以下哪些是用于定义字段属性的关键字?
A.NOTNULL
B.PRIMARYKEY
C.UNIQUE
D.DEFAULT
E.AUTO_INCREMENT
3.